ダイ(DAI)を使ったスマートコントラクトの魅力
分散型金融(DeFi)の隆盛に伴い、スマートコントラクトの重要性はますます高まっています。その中でも、MakerDAOによって発行されるステーブルコインであるダイ(DAI)は、スマートコントラクトとの親和性が高く、DeFiエコシステムにおいて重要な役割を果たしています。本稿では、ダイの特性、スマートコントラクトとの連携、そしてその魅力について詳細に解説します。
1. ダイ(DAI)とは
ダイは、担保によって価値が裏付けられた分散型ステーブルコインです。他のステーブルコインが法定通貨などの資産にペッグされているのに対し、ダイは暗号資産を担保として、過剰担保型(Over-Collateralized)の仕組みを採用しています。具体的には、イーサリアム(ETH)などの暗号資産をMakerDAOのスマートコントラクトに預け入れ、その担保価値に応じてダイを発行します。担保価値がダイの価値を上回るように設計されているため、価格変動リスクを軽減し、安定性を確保しています。
ダイの価格安定メカニズムは、MakerDAOのスマートコントラクトによって自動的に調整されます。ダイの価格が1ドルを上回る場合、MakerDAOのガバナンスによって金利が引き上げられ、ダイの発行を抑制します。逆に、ダイの価格が1ドルを下回る場合、金利が引き下げられ、ダイの発行を促進します。このメカニズムにより、ダイは市場の需給バランスに応じて価格を調整し、1ドルへのペッグを維持しようとします。
2. スマートコントラクトとダイの連携
ダイは、スマートコントラクトとの連携において、いくつかの重要な利点を提供します。まず、ダイはERC-20トークンとして実装されているため、イーサリアム上で動作する多くのスマートコントラクトと互換性があります。これにより、DeFiアプリケーションの開発者は、既存のインフラストラクチャを活用して、ダイを容易に統合することができます。
ダイは、DeFiアプリケーションにおける様々なユースケースで活用されています。例えば、レンディングプラットフォームでは、ユーザーがダイを貸し出すことで利息を得ることができます。また、DEX(分散型取引所)では、ダイは取引ペアとして利用され、他の暗号資産との交換を可能にします。さらに、イールドファーミングや流動性マイニングなどのDeFi戦略においても、ダイは重要な役割を果たしています。
ダイのスマートコントラクトは、透明性と不変性を備えています。MakerDAOのスマートコントラクトは、オープンソースで公開されており、誰でもコードを監査することができます。これにより、スマートコントラクトのセキュリティと信頼性を高めることができます。また、スマートコントラクトは一度デプロイされると、変更することができないため、不正な操作や改ざんを防ぐことができます。
3. ダイを使ったスマートコントラクトの具体的な例
3.1. レンディングプラットフォーム
AaveやCompoundなどのレンディングプラットフォームでは、ダイは貸し出しや借り入れの対象となる資産として利用されています。ユーザーは、ダイをプラットフォームに預け入れることで利息を得ることができ、また、他の暗号資産を担保としてダイを借り入れることもできます。ダイの安定性は、レンディングプラットフォームにおけるリスクを軽減し、ユーザーに安心して利用できる環境を提供します。
3.2. 分散型取引所(DEX)
UniswapやSushiSwapなどのDEXでは、ダイは取引ペアとして利用され、他の暗号資産との交換を可能にします。ダイの流動性は、DEXにおける取引の円滑性を高め、ユーザーに効率的な取引体験を提供します。また、ダイの価格安定性は、DEXにおける価格変動リスクを軽減し、ユーザーに安心して取引できる環境を提供します。
3.3. イールドファーミング
Yearn.financeなどのイールドファーミングプラットフォームでは、ダイは様々なDeFiプロトコルに預け入れられ、利息や報酬を得るために利用されています。ダイの多様なDeFiプロトコルへの統合は、イールドファーミングの機会を拡大し、ユーザーに高い収益性を提供します。また、ダイのスマートコントラクトは、イールドファーミング戦略の自動化を可能にし、ユーザーの負担を軽減します。
3.4. 保険プロトコル
Nexus Mutualなどの保険プロトコルでは、ダイは保険料の支払いや保険金の受取りに使用されます。ダイの安定性は、保険プロトコルにおける価格変動リスクを軽減し、ユーザーに安心して保険サービスを利用できる環境を提供します。また、ダイのスマートコントラクトは、保険契約の自動化を可能にし、ユーザーの負担を軽減します。
4. ダイのメリットとデメリット
4.1. メリット
- 価格安定性: 過剰担保型メカニズムにより、価格変動リスクを軽減し、安定性を確保しています。
- 分散性: MakerDAOのガバナンスによって管理されており、中央集権的な管理主体が存在しません。
- 透明性: スマートコントラクトのコードはオープンソースで公開されており、誰でも監査することができます。
- 互換性: ERC-20トークンとして実装されており、多くのスマートコントラクトと互換性があります。
- DeFiエコシステムとの親和性: レンディング、DEX、イールドファーミングなど、様々なDeFiアプリケーションで活用されています。
4.2. デメリット
- 過剰担保: ダイを発行するためには、担保価値がダイの価値を上回る暗号資産を預け入れる必要があります。
- 清算リスク: 担保価値が低下した場合、担保が清算されるリスクがあります。
- ガバナンスリスク: MakerDAOのガバナンスによってダイのパラメータが変更される可能性があります。
- スマートコントラクトリスク: スマートコントラクトの脆弱性により、資金が失われるリスクがあります。
5. 今後の展望
ダイは、DeFiエコシステムの成長とともに、今後ますます重要な役割を果たすことが期待されます。MakerDAOは、ダイの安定性とスケーラビリティを向上させるために、様々な改善策を検討しています。例えば、マルチチェーン展開や新しい担保資産の導入などが挙げられます。また、ダイのスマートコントラクトは、より複雑なDeFiアプリケーションに対応できるように進化していくでしょう。
ダイの普及は、DeFiエコシステムの成熟を促進し、より多くの人々が金融サービスにアクセスできるようになる可能性があります。ダイの透明性と分散性は、従来の金融システムにおける不透明性と中央集権的な管理体制を克服し、より公平で効率的な金融システムを構築する上で重要な役割を果たすでしょう。
まとめ
ダイは、スマートコントラクトとの親和性が高く、DeFiエコシステムにおいて重要な役割を果たしているステーブルコインです。価格安定性、分散性、透明性、互換性などのメリットを備えており、レンディング、DEX、イールドファーミングなど、様々なDeFiアプリケーションで活用されています。ダイの普及は、DeFiエコシステムの成熟を促進し、より多くの人々が金融サービスにアクセスできるようになる可能性があります。今後も、ダイの進化とDeFiエコシステムの発展に注目していく必要があります。